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Property: Larger properties require more extensive drainage systems.
- Type of Drainage System: Different systems, such as French drains or surface drains, vary in cost.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Vancouver, WA can influence the overall cost.
- Materials Used: High-quality materials can increase the cost but also the longevity of the system.
- Permitting Fees: Local regulations may require permits, adding to the cost.
- Complexity of Installation: Difficult installations, such as those requiring excavation, can be more expensive.
- Maintenance Requirements: Regular maintenance needs can affect the long-term cost.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Vancouver, WA) |
---|---|
Initial Consultation | $100 - $200 |
Site Inspection | $150 - $300 |
French Drain Installation | $20 - $30 per linear foot |
Surface Drain Installation | $10 - $20 per linear foot |
Catch Basin Installation | $500 - $1,000 each |
Permitting Fees | $50 - $200 |
Regular Maintenance | $100 - $300 per visit |
Emergency Repairs | $200 - $600 per incident |
